Every white girl's father's worst nightmare': High School students walk out over white assistant principal's shocking retweet poking fun at interracial couples
Students at a Norfolk, Virginia, high school staged a walk-out Monday to protest a racially charged Twitter post mocking interracial couples, which has been sent out by a high-ranking school administrator who is white.
Miss Strickland, a recent hire at the predominantly black high school, retweeted a post from the satirical account @OrNahhTweets that featured a prom photo showing seven couples where all the women were white and all the young men were African-American
The image was accompanied by a caption that read: ‘every white girl's father's worst nightmare Or Nah?'
'I could have been any one of the boys in the picture,' Booker T Washington junior Michael LeMelle, who is African-American, told the station WAVY. 'And I really don’t see myself... as anyone’s worst nightmare.
LeMelle was one of about a dozen students who walked out of their classes Monday to call the administration’s attention to the ongoing controversy.
Students said that they have appealed to the faculty last week to look into the retweet, but their pleas have fallen on deaf ears.
The NAACP also has weighed in on the scandal, saying in a statement to ABC 13NewsNow that the civil rights organization has launched its own investigation into the controversy surrounding the racially insensitive tweet.
